Electron-Nuclear Double Resonance of Samarium 147 and Samarium 149 Tripositive Ions in Lanthanum Trichloride Single Crystals

Abstract
The electron-nuclear-double-resonance spectral frequencies of Sm+3147 and Sm+3149 ions dilutely substituted at La+3 ion sites in LaCl3 single crystals at 2.07 °K have been measured. The experimental results for both nuclides have been summarized by giving values of the parameters in a spin Hamiltonian for a least-squares best fit to the measurements. The values of (a) nuclear g factors and nuclear magnetic-dipole moments for both nuclides, of (b) r3 for the f electron-nuclear distance in Sm+3, of (c) ratios of nuclear magnetic-dipole moments and (d) ratios of nuclear electric-quadrupole moments for the two nuclides, and of (e) the ratio of the crystal-field shielding and antishielding factors 1σ2 and 1γ for Sm+3 in LaCl2, which are obtainable from these measurements, are discussed and tabulated.
